Log Message:
ufs: fixed signed/unsigned bugs affecting large file systems

Apply these commits from FreeBSD:

  commit e870d1e6f97cc73308c11c40684b775bcfa906a2
  Author: Kirk McKusick <mckus...@freebsd.org>
  Date:   Wed Feb 10 20:10:35 2010 +0000

    This fix corrects a problem in the file system that treats large
    inode numbers as negative rather than unsigned. For a default
    (16K block) file system, this bug began to show up at a file system
    size above about 16Tb.

    To fully handle this problem, newfs must be updated to ensure that
    it will never create a filesystem with more than 2^32 inodes. That
    patch will be forthcoming soon.

    Reported by: Scott Burns, John Kilburg, Bruce Evans
    Followup by: Jeff Roberson
    PR:          133980
    MFC after:   2 weeks

  commit 81479e688b0f643ffacd3f335b4b4bba460b769d
  Author: Kirk McKusick <mckus...@freebsd.org>
  Date:   Thu Feb 11 18:14:53 2010 +0000

    One last pass to get all the unsigned comparisons correct.

In additional to the changes from FreeBSD, this commit includes quite a few
related changes to appease -Wsign-compare.
